This is an soft eggless cake topped with a little frosting and orange sauce

INGREDIENTS FOR THE CAKE
All purpose flour 1 3/4 cup(1+3/4)
Butter 3/4 cup
Sugar 3/4 cup( powdered)
Baking powder 1 1/2 tsp(one and half)
Baking soda 3/4 tsp
Orange squash 6 tbsp
Milk 3/4 cup
ORANGE SAUCE
1/2 cup orange juice
2 tbsp Honey
1 tbsp corn flour
Mix all the ingredients and cook it on a slow flame till it attains a coating texture. cool it
PREPARATION
Sift maida, baking powder and baking soda together.
In a bowl cream butter and powdered sugar till fluffy
Add milk and beat again
Now add the orange squash and beat further till very creamy.
When you add the milk and squash and start beating, the mixture might look as if it is curdling. IGNORE this and beat further till it attains a rich creamy texture.
Now add flour and beat further.
Grease a ring mould or a cake mould 8" and scoop the batter into it
Bake the cake at 180C for 25 minutes
The cake will shrink from the side and will spring back when touched
Cool it on a wire rack
When completely cool drizzle the orange sauce on it alternatively with the butter cream frosting.
